Budget Planning Scenario for Non-Monetary or Non-FTE Unit of Measure Class

Has anyone worked with the Budget Planning process in D365 Finance and Operations where they successfully generated a budget plan using the /Quantity/ Unit of Measure with the Hours or Time UOM as the scenario?  I have a client that wants to capture hours (i.e., 250 hrs) as a percentage of total hours (1000 hrs) and multiply that percentage (.25) by an employee's salary ($75,000) and apply that cost ($18,750) in a budget plan.

    Budget Planning Scenario for Non-Monetary or Non-FTE Unit of Measure Class
    Hi,
    There is no such out-of-the-box standard functionality, you'll have to build custom development to be able to generate budget plans, measured in Hours or Time.
